首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
文本,正则RegExp,text,string,字符串处理
kfepiza
创建于2022-11-04
订阅专栏
文本,正则RegExp,text,string,字符串处理
暂无订阅
共40篇文章
创建于2022-11-04
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
RegExp正则表达式左限定右限定左右限定,预查询,预查寻,断言 : (?<= , (?= , (?<! , (?!
RegExp正则表达式左限定右限定左右限定,预查询,预查寻,断言 : (?<= , (?= , (?<! , (?! 有好多种称呼 (?<= , (?= , (?<! , (?! 有好多种称呼 , 我
正则表达式预查寻也称断言,限定左右相邻内容
正则表达式预查寻也称断言,限定左右相邻内容 正则表达式预查寻分为 4 种: 正向肯定预查: (?=pattern) (?=pattern) 正向否定预查: (?!pattern) (?!pattern
Js的$&如同 sed的& java的$0 指代matcher匹配到的内容的符号
Js的$&如同 sed的& java的$0 $& 可用于Js,Vscode,RJTextEd,editplus,notepad++, 在 Vscode,RJTextEd,editplus,notepa
grep笔记240103
常用选项:: -i:忽略大小写进行匹配。 -v:反向匹配,只打印不匹配的行。 -n:显示匹配行的行号。 -r:递归查找子目录中的文件。 -l:只打印匹配的文件名。 -c:只打印匹配的行数。 -A: 空
grep -A -B -C 输出匹配行及相邻行
grep -A -B -C 输出匹配行及相邻行 grep --help 摘抄👇 man grep摘抄 grep输出匹配行及之后几行用 -A 数值 -A 或 --after-context=数值或 --
grep输出匹配行及之前几行用 `-C` 数值
grep输出匹配行及之前几行用 -C 数值 -C 数值 或 --context=数值或 --context 数值,等号可有可无 打印前后 <数值> 行上下文 打印出匹配的行的上下文前后各 NUM 行。
grep输出匹配行及之前几行用 `-B` 数值
grep输出匹配行及之前几行用 -B 数值 -B 数值 或 --before-context=数值或 --before-context 数值,等号可有可无 打印前面 <数值> 行上下文 打印出匹配的行
分别用 grep,sed,awk 实现文本筛选过滤功能
筛选ip address show的ipv4 ip address show可简写为ip address可简写为ip a 也可不写{}, 当没有大括号{}时, 相当于有{print $0}={prin
awk笔记231129
awk的脚本套路是: awk的脚步部分最好用一对单引号将 'BEGIN{} /pattern1/{}.../patternN/{} END{}' 套起来, 因为常用到$号, $号在单引号中不会被转义,
awk,sed都可以用&号表示查找结果,给查找结果加括号反引号
给命令选项加上反引号 在awk中 sub函数 和 gsub函数 的区别 在awk中,sub和gsub都用于进行字符串替换操作,但它们在替换范围上有所不同。 sub函数: sub函数用于在字符串中进行一
在awk中 sub函数 和 gsub函数 的区别
在awk中 sub函数 和 gsub函数 的区别 简单说就是正则加g和不加g的效果, sub匹配每行第一个,gsub匹配每行所有 在Awk中,sub函数和gsub函数都是用于字符串替换的函数,但它们之
grep笔记231128 grep的 -e , -E , -F , -G , -P 有什么区别
grep的 -e , -E , -F , -G , -P 有什么区别 grep 是一个常用的命令行工具,用于在文本文件中搜索匹配指定模式的行。-e、-E、-F、-G 和 -P 是 grep 的选项,它
vi vim 末尾编辑按GA 在最后一行下方新增一行编辑按Go
vim 快速跳到文件末尾 在最后一行下方新增一行 移到末尾,并且进入文本录入模式 GA (大写G大写A) 在一般模式(刚进入的模式,esc模式) GA 或 Shift +ga 先 G 或 shift+
awk:gawk,mawk,nawk的选项笔记221109
awk的选项 通用常用选项, -F 指定分隔符 -f 指定脚本文件 (注意:是脚本文件, 不是输入文件, 输入文件写在末尾) -v 定义awk自己的变量, 例如 -v name=小明 这三个选项符合
awk:gawk,mawk,nawk 介绍笔记221108
AWK介绍 简介: AWK是一种解释性编程语言,主要用于文本处理。之所以叫AWK是因为其取了三位创始人Alfred Aho,Peter Weinberger,和Brian Kernighan 的 Fa
awk:gawk,mawk,nawk 介绍笔记221108
AWK介绍 简介: AWK是一种解释性编程语言,主要用于文本处理。之所以叫AWK是因为其取了三位创始人Alfred Aho,Peter Weinberger,和Brian Kernighan 的 Fa
Linux 文本替换 字符串替换 221012笔记
Linux 文本替换 字符串替换 用 sed 命令进行文本字符串替换 公式 sed s/被替换/替换/g 或 sed -e s/被替换/替换/g 或 sed --expression s/被替换/替换
grep -v 反匹配输出,结果取反,输出不匹配的行,输出不匹配的结果,反匹配,不匹配表达式,输出与表达式不匹配的内容
grep (缩写来自Globally search a Regular Expression and Print)是一种强大的文本搜索工具,它能使用特定模式匹配(包括正则表达式)搜索文本,并默认输出匹
awk,gawk基本用法笔记221107
AWK是一种编程语言。AWK 有几种实现方式(主要以解释器的形式)。AWK已被编入POSIX中。今天使用的主要实现是: nawk(“ new awk”,oawk原始UNIX实现的演变),已在* BSD
awk,gawk调用shell,bash中的变量 笔记221106
awk,gawk调用shell,bash中的变量 笔记221106 "'${变量名}'" 双 包 单 包 ${} 包 变量名 "'"${变量名}"'" 双 包 单 包 双 包 ${} 包 变量名 方法